Who today has not heard about the Large Hadron Collider, about the black holes that can arise there and swallow us all, as well as about the elusive Higgs boson, which physicists are so eager to discover. But why humanity should spend huge amounts of money on giant accelerators and why it is so important to us, this Higgs boson, is not clear to everyone. Ian Sample, a renowned science columnist, Guardian and New Scientist contributor, who was named Journalist of the Year by the Association of British Science Writers in 2005, answers these difficult questions in his book. The sample tells in a fascinating and humorous way about outstanding ideas and outstanding scientists of our time, searching for and finding ways into the Unknown.
